Motor devri h\u0131zland\u0131\u011f\u0131nda, turbo (Turbo asl\u0131nda motor egzozunu g\u00fc\u00e7 kayna\u011f\u0131 olarak kullanan bir hava kompres\u00f6r\u00fcd\u00fcr; bu g\u00fc\u00e7, (s\u0131ra hava kanal\u0131nda bulunan) t\u00fcrbin odas\u0131ndaki t\u00fcrbini ve giri\u015fteki e\u015f eksenli \u00e7ark\u0131 tahrik eder) \u00c7ark, hava filtresi borusundan g\u00f6nderilen taze havay\u0131 s\u0131k\u0131\u015ft\u0131r\u0131r; egzoz tahliye h\u0131z\u0131 ve t\u00fcrbin h\u0131z\u0131 e\u015fzamanl\u0131 olarak h\u0131zland\u0131r\u0131larak hava s\u0131k\u0131\u015ft\u0131rma seviyesi art\u0131r\u0131l\u0131r; motora giren hava miktar\u0131 buna g\u00f6re artar; bu da motorun \u00e7\u0131k\u0131\u015f g\u00fcc\u00fcn\u00fc art\u0131rabilir ve motor g\u00fcc\u00fc ile torkunda \u00f6nemli bir art\u0131\u015f sa\u011flar. Motor, s\u00fcper\u015farjdan ge\u00e7tikten sonra en y\u00fcksek patlama bas\u0131nc\u0131n\u0131 ve ortalama s\u0131cakl\u0131\u011f\u0131 \u00f6nemli \u00f6l\u00e7\u00fcde art\u0131racakt\u0131r. Bu durum, motorun mekanik \u00f6zelliklerini ve ya\u011flama \u00f6zelliklerini etkileyecektir; ancak ayn\u0131 zamanda emme havas\u0131 s\u0131cakl\u0131\u011f\u0131n\u0131 da art\u0131racakt\u0131r. Bu nedenle, emme havas\u0131 s\u0131cakl\u0131\u011f\u0131n\u0131 d\u00fc\u015f\u00fcrmek i\u00e7in s\u00fcper\u015farjl\u0131 motorlarda genellikle bir emme havas\u0131 so\u011futma cihaz\u0131 kullan\u0131lmas\u0131 gerekir; ayr\u0131ca motorun boyutu ve a\u011f\u0131rl\u0131\u011f\u0131 da artacakt\u0131r. Uzun s\u00fcreli y\u00fcksek devirli motor \u00e7al\u0131\u015fmas\u0131n\u0131n ard\u0131ndan, turbo\u015farj rotoru yata\u011f\u0131n\u0131n ya\u011flanmas\u0131 ve motorun so\u011futulmas\u0131 i\u00e7in yerel ya\u011f beslemesi sa\u011flan\u0131r; motor aniden durduruldu\u011funda ya\u011f bas\u0131nc\u0131 h\u0131zla s\u0131f\u0131ra d\u00fc\u015fer, turbo\u015farj t\u00fcrbininin y\u00fcksek s\u0131cakl\u0131\u011f\u0131, \u0131s\u0131y\u0131 ta\u015f\u0131yan yatak kovan\u0131n\u0131n orta k\u0131sm\u0131na ula\u015f\u0131r ve bu \u0131s\u0131 h\u0131zla uzakla\u015ft\u0131r\u0131lamaz; bu s\u0131rada turbo\u015farj rotoru, y\u00fcksek h\u0131zda d\u00f6nmenin atalet etkisi alt\u0131nda kal\u0131r; bu nedenle motorun aniden durdurulmas\u0131 durumunda, turbo\u015farj i\u00e7indeki ya\u011f\u0131n a\u015f\u0131r\u0131 \u0131s\u0131nmas\u0131na ve yataklar\u0131n ile milin hasar g\u00f6rmesine neden olur. \u00d6zellikle gaz kelebe\u011finin aniden kapanarak ani bir sars\u0131nt\u0131ya neden olmas\u0131n\u0131 \u00f6nlemek i\u00e7in.<br \/>\nKompres\u00f6r pervanesinin y\u00fcksek h\u0131zda d\u00f6nmesi s\u0131ras\u0131nda toz ve di\u011fer kirlerin girmesini \u00f6nleyin; 3. H\u0131zdan kaynaklanan dengesizlik veya bur\u00e7lar ile contalarda a\u015f\u0131nman\u0131n artmas\u0131na neden olabilir.\u00a0Motor ya\u011f\u0131 ve filtresi, kirlerin girmesini \u00f6nlemek i\u00e7in temiz tutulmal\u0131d\u0131r; aksi takdirde ya\u011flama kapasitesi azal\u0131r ve bu da turbo\u015farj\u0131n erken ar\u0131zalanmas\u0131na neden olur. Turbo\u015farj grubunu temiz tutmak i\u00e7in t\u00fcm ba\u011flant\u0131 par\u00e7alar\u0131 temiz bir bezle iyice kapat\u0131lmal\u0131d\u0131r; b\u00f6ylece kirlerin turbo\u015farja d\u00fc\u015fmesi ve rotora zarar vermesi \u00f6nlenir. Turbo\u015farj genellikle y\u00fcksek s\u0131cakl\u0131klarda \u00e7al\u0131\u015ft\u0131\u011f\u0131ndan, y\u00fcksek s\u0131cakl\u0131k nedeniyle ya\u011f boru hatt\u0131n\u0131n i\u00e7 k\u0131sm\u0131nda bir miktar kok olu\u015fmas\u0131 muhtemeldir; bu durum, rulmanlar\u0131n yeterince ya\u011flanmamas\u0131na ve dolay\u0131s\u0131yla turbo\u015farj\u0131n hasar g\u00f6rmesine yol a\u00e7ar. Bu nedenle, ya\u011f boru hatt\u0131 bir s\u00fcre \u00e7al\u0131\u015ft\u0131ktan sonra temizlenmelidir.<br \/>\nAirway, borunun ba\u011flant\u0131s\u0131n\u0131 kontrol etmeli ve turbo\u015farj\u0131n \u00e7al\u0131\u015fmas\u0131n\u0131 her zaman dikkatle kontrol etmelidir.
